Doodlehopper 4 Kids

4.7 (125)

234 W Broad St, Falls Church, VA 22046
(703) 241-2262
doodlehopper.com

Claimed
Toy store
Family-owned toy store for 20+ years with children's books, party decor & a birthday registry.

It’s an ok store if you have kids but not so great for adult collectors. I’ll still find something interesting there on occasion which keeps me coming in from time to time but mostly it’s kinda mid, with a Unique inventory organization style that kinda makes sense but is also Kinda confusing. Whereas most toy stores, even small ones, organize toys by play pattern, e.g.: action figures with action figures, Solid plastic animals all together, Barbies with other Dolls etc. but here, while there’s some Semblance of separation by play pattern with Lego being mostly separate from plush and Infant toys, it seems to be mostly organized into far more vague sections based on theme or like what it is, with all things Dinosaur related in one place (be it plastic dinosaurs, Jurassic World toys, Fossil digging sets, plush sand box toys Etc) all the Space and Science stuff in another, all the Star Wars Stuff clustered together in a corner of the lego wall. like I said it makes some sense when you think about it, but it’s definitely chaotic, confusing and Antithetical to how most kids and parents shop. I mean it makes sense if you come in looking for Dinosaurs, but It’s baffling if you’re looking for Outdoor toys.

For their selection and wonderful staff, I'd give them 5 stars, but that's not enough to make up for the few MAJOR drawbacks to this location:Parking: there's a lot of it, but the store is 100% INACCESSIBLE if you can't navigate stairs. No ramps anywhere, plus a step up into the back door of the shop and only non-handicapped street parking (on a VERY busy road) in front. This is an ADA nightmare, and if you have a child who has mobility issues or is wheelchair bound, you will have difficulty gaining access to the store.Size: They recently (well, within the last 2 years) reduced their store size, making it VERY tight to navigate. Again, for people who are mobility impaired or on crutches or wheelchair bound, it is a logistical PITA. They have so much to see, and a lot less space to see it all in.....what they lost was maneuverability for their customers.For me, being mobility impaired, both of these things are an issue....and as much as I love the store and the people who work there, it may be what causes me to stop shopping there. They used to have a second location much closer to my home, but that closed recently....it was much more accessible, much larger, and I wish they'd closed this location in favor of the Springfield one.
